Get PriceIn recent years, rapid development has led to an increased demand for river sand as a source of construction material. This has resulted in a mushrooming of river sand mining activities which have given rise to various problems that require urgent action by the authorities. These include river bank erosion, river bed degradation, river buffer zone encroachment and deterioration …

Get PriceSand + Silt Layer Height or Thickness = 10 cm. Silt Content of Sand = (1 cm / 10 cm) x 100 %. Silt Content of Sand = 1%. So, from the above Test and calculations, we can say that this sand has a 1% silt content. The silt content limit in the sand as per IS code is 8%, so this sand we can use for construction purposes.

Get PriceIntroduction. Sand and gravel are used extensively in construction. In the preparation of concrete, for each tonne of cement, the building industry needs about six to seven times more tonnes of sand and gravel (USGS, 2013b). Thus, the world's use of aggregates for concrete can be estimated at billion to billion tonnes a year for 2022 alone.

Get Price· Sea sand does not have high compressive strength, high tensile strength, so it cannot be used in construction activities. Sea sand contains salts which deteriorates the plastered surface and the slab surface and in the long run cause seepage in the building. The salt in sea sand tends to absorb moisture from atmosphere, bringing dampness.
Get PriceGrains of sand that have been shaped by water (, river sand and beach sand) are rounded and uniform in size. Crushed rock, on the other hand, produces sand grains that are course, with jagged edges, and not uniform in size. Rounded sand grains of uniform size, when packed together, do not produce pore spaces small enough to be effective as sand filter media. …

Get PriceTesting of Sand Quality at Construction Site Following are the tests for sand at construction site: Organic impurities test – this test is conducted at the field, for every 20 cum or part thereof.; Silt content test – this is also a field test and to be conducted for every 20 cum.; Particle size distribution - this test can be conducted at site or in laboratory for every 40 cum of sand.
Get Price· In China, during the 1980s and 90s, companies mined construction sand from the Yangtze River. Thousand-foot sections of riverbank routinely collapsed, shipping lanes were blocked, and water supply equipment became clogged with sediment. Finally, in 2022, as bridges began to weaken, the Chinese government banned sand mining on the Yangtze River, and …
Get Price· Green sand consists of high-quality silica sand, about 10 percent bentonite clay (as the binder), 2 to 5 percent water and about 5 percent sea coal (a carbonaceous mold additive to improve casting finish). The type of metal being cast determines which additives and what gradation of sand is used. The green sand used in the process constitutes upwards of 90 …
